10 Cool DIY IKEA Play Kitchen Hacks

Fri, Aug 10, 2012 | 0-2, 2-4, 5-7, DIY Projects | By Mike

If you was on a market searching for a play kitchen for your kids you’ve probably already seen these prices. Even in IKEA such kitchen is quite expensive. Although you can get some inspiration from the projects we’ve gathered and build an awesome play kitchen by yourself. You can use things from IKEA to do that. Night stands, chairs, bookcases and lots of other things from this great store would work as a charm. You can even choose parts that you won’t need to repaint. Check out these projects and make the best play kitchen for your kid to make her or him proud.
